The Challenge
Global media production teams experienced severe publishing delays caused by manual asset approvals, fragmented email chains, and lost metadata tags across Slack channels.
The Solution
Engineered intelligent Slack agents that automatically detect media links, validate metadata tags, and route asset approvals to project managers.
Agentic bot operating inside Slack channels to triage approvals, run automated checks, and notify senior editors.
AI model automatically categorizes video clips, images, and metadata for instant searching in central DAM systems.
Serverless Webhook engine built on AWS Lambda ensuring instant sub-second response times during live broadcasting.
